Algonquin Park Weather in May
During May, Algonquin Park experiences moderate daytime temperatures of 17°C (63°F) and cooler nights around 6°C (43°F). Expect quite a bit of rainfall. Around 87 mm (3.4 in) is typical.
Rainfall in Algonquin Park in May
On average, there are about 13 days with rain during this month, averaging 87 mm (3.4 in). A fairly balanced picture this month, some wet days but nothing too extreme in terms of intensity.
Temperature in Algonquin Park in May
In May, expect moderate temperatures in Algonquin Park, with highs of 17°C (63°F) and lows of 6°C (43°F) at night. Conditions are often most pleasant around the middle of the day. With overnight lows of 6°C (43°F), nights are cold.
